Sirius Interactive Ltd. Sirius Interactive provides high-quality language services to research and academic communities Our team comprises specialist editors from various disciplines.

Sirius Interactive is dedicated to providing high-quality language services to research and academic communities while maintaining the highest standards for confidentiality, security, and privacy. We have supported authors around the world in getting their work published by eliminating a major obstacle—the English language barrier. We specialize in editing non-native English and offer a full range

of services for authors who want to publish in high-impact journals. We also focus on author education and provide writing and language training workshops to train young researchers in the fine art of academic writing, enabling them to prepare well-written manuscripts that are guaranteed to be accepted for publication. We offer customized partnerships to university departments, research organizations, and translation companies.
